CAPS Grades
This kit is primarily designed for Foundation Phase and Intermediate Phase learners, as it deals entirely with permanent magnets and magnetic forces rather than dynamic electric currents.
1. Foundation Phase: Grade 1, 2, and 3 (Life Skills: Beginning Knowledge)
- Curriculum Context: Learners are introduced to the properties of different materials in their everyday environment.
- Kit Application: Ideal for introducing the basic concept of attraction. Teachers use it to show that magnets stick to certain metals (like iron/steel paperclips) but do not stick to plastic, wood, or paper.
2. Intermediate Phase: Grade 4 and 5 (Natural Sciences and Technology)
- Term 1 (Grade 4): Matter and Materials
- Application: Testing solid materials to sort them into "magnetic" and "non-magnetic" categories.
- Term 1 (Grade 5): Metals and Non-metals
- Application: Deepening the understanding of property differences between metallic items and non-metals.
3. Intermediate Phase: Grade 6 (Natural Sciences and Technology)
- Term 3 Topic: Electric Circuits (Introduction to Fields)
- Application: Before learners study electromagnets (like the circuit kit you viewed earlier), they must understand how permanent magnets work.
- Key Concept: Using the bar and horseshoe magnets to demonstrate the Laws of Magnetism (Like poles repel each other; opposite poles attract each other).
